Beaches from DE to VA close as medical waste washes ashore

Authorities have closed access to waters at beaches from Delaware to Virginia’s Eastern Shore due to debris with medical waste washing ashore. Sunday brought a series of beach closures rolling down the East Coast. The Town of Fenwick Island in Delaware announced swimming closures following reports of medical waste washing ashore from Indian River Inlet to Fenwick Island. The Town said it was sending out an emergency response team. Closures continued through the early days of this week as debris, “including syringes,” reportedly continued washing ashore. Truck crash leaves trailer standing upright in New Kent

A single vehicle trailer-trailer crash shut down part of I-64 West in New Kent for hours on Thursday. According to VSP, at about 9:30 a.m., the truck was heading westbound when, at the 200 mile marker, the raised bed hit the overhead traffic sign. VSP said the bed separated from the cab and remained upright against the damaged highway sign. The bed was finally removed at about 11 a.m. (Photo: VSP) While the hours-long response was underway, traffic was diverted from I-64 West onto county roads prompting New Kent County Sheriff’s Office to issue a message warning of heavy traffic throughout that rural county.
